備忘録的プログラミングリファレンス

:any-link クラス

 :any-link クラスは、リンク機能をもつエレメントを対象に設定されたスタイルを反映する擬似クラスです。リンク機能をもつエレメントであればすべて対象になります。
 リンク機能をもつエレメントには、<a><area> エレメントがあります。

:any-link
a:any-link{
	color: yellow;
}

動作の確認はExampleを参照してください

 :any-link クラス、:link:visited クラスの指定は、後で指定したプロパティによって上書きされます。

ページ内 Index

構文(Syntax)

CSS

HTMLElement:any-link {
  style_propaty: value;
	...
}

DOM ( JavaScript )

 疑似クラスはDOM ( JavaScript )から操作できません。
 スタイルのみの操作は擬似クラスを利用したほうが簡易です。

Example

 :any-linkの例です。

:any-link クラス、:link:visited クラスの設定は、設定した順によって上書きされます。
 :any-link クラスよりも:link:visited クラスを後で指定すると、:link:visitedクラスの設定で上書きされます。
 :link:visited クラスよりも後で :any-link クラスを指定すると、:any-link クラスの設定で上書きされます。